A huge blow for The Wallabies considering that most of the RWC cup games will be played late at night in damp or wet conditions. Poor conditions equals more scrums due to more knock ons etc. The Wallabies scrum has been below par for years and it's certainly not going to get any better now after losing Robinson. RD will be holding his breath against Samoa and during the Tri Nations and hoping that they get through unscathed because depth is certainly an issue especially in the front row.
